Here’s where it gets technical: PDRN works by activating the adenosine A2A receptor pathway. This isn’t just another hydration booster – it’s a cellular reset button. When applied topically or injected, these DNA fragments trick damaged cells into behaving like they’re in “repair mode.” A 2021 study published in the *International Journal of Molecular Sciences* showed PDRN increases fibroblast proliferation by 38% compared to placebo, with collagen type I production spiking within 72 hours of application.
